When should I book my newborn lifestyle session?

I recommend that you book your newborn lifestyle session within the first 14 days of your baby's life. However, since I don't do any posed newborn work, it isn't 100% necessary that the session occurs in those first 2 weeks. Since birth and healing can be so unpredictable, I am more than happy to schedule your newborn lifestyle session anytime in the first 3 months of life.
